I'm finding that when I'm in a call, if I have to use the dial pad to select anything for those computer operators, the numbers on the dialpad don't works at all. At least not the ones that are in the white that are in the phone app in the recents menu.
That's the one you use to make the call in the first place.

But, if I swipe down to the call in progress dialog that dialpad works just fine. Weird and annoying but at least I found out how to get something. The problem with this is that you have to be real careful not to hang up from that little rectangle. Also if you go into recent, they is only the other phone app as an option. Anyone know if this is a lollipop issue or something with ZenUI that they may need to fix?
 
It looks like the dialpads are different. Use the In Call dialpad, which is the one with the dark background. The one with the light background is only used to initiate the call. Kind of an odd quirk--I've never tried this on my Nexus 5, but I suspect it's a ZenUI thing.
